A vendor agreement and a purchase order serve related but distinct purposes. A contract tailored to your risk and performance needs provides enforceable protections, while a purchase order typically records a transaction. Relying solely on a PO can leave gaps in liability, remedies, and long term risk management. A written agreement clarifies expectations and dispute resolution.
A strong vendor contract should define scope, pricing, delivery, acceptance, warranties, confidentiality, and termination. It should specify remedies for non performance, risk allocation, governing law, and dispute resolution. Consider adding audit rights, change management procedures, and clear renewal terms to support ongoing procurement stability.

Templates offer speed but risk rigidity. Customized contracts reflect your specific supply chain, risk profile, and industry standards, reducing gaps. If a delivery deadline is missed, the contract should specify notice requirements, remedies, and possible liquidated damages or credits. Having defined escalation steps helps preserve relationships while providing a fair path to remediation. Timely notification and documented performance data support efficient resolution.
Price changes can be handled through indexed pricing, capped increases, or defined adjustment mechanisms tied to raw material costs. The contract should specify when price changes are allowed, notice periods, and any limits. Transparent pricing terms reduce disputes and support budgeting for Forest Oaks operations.
Confidentiality protects sensitive information such as pricing, strategies, and supplier lists. The agreement should carve out required disclosures for regulatory purposes and ensure defined remedies for breach. Strong confidentiality supports competitive positioning and smoother collaboration with trusted suppliers.
Disputes are typically resolved through a structured path that may include negotiation, mediation, and arbitration. The contract should specify governing law, venue, and the parties’ rights. A clear procedure reduces delays and preserves relationships while providing a fair framework for resolution.
